Bro Harrell wrote:

> New topic....I've heard many times that since the correct term is FRUIT
> of the Spirit, not the plural FRUITS, that when one is saved and filled
> with the Spirit, that all of these characteristics comprise ONE FRUIT,
> and therefore all should be present in the life of a child of God.
> 
> I beg to differ with this point.

I've heard this too and I agree with you Bro Harrell.  It's merely a
point of grammar -- the plural of fruit is, well, "fruit," not
"fruits."

If I have a fruit salad I did not eat a single strawberry, I ate a bowl
of stuff with melons and bananas and apples and strawberries, and kiwi
fruit all topped off with some whipped cream.

I don't have a "fruits bowl," but my fruit bowl at home can hold
several bananas and apples and oranges.  Fruit-of-the-loom
undergarments have a picture on the tag showing a variety of fruit (not
"fruits").
